**A rather new Canada Day tradition is picking up some steam. Ride with Fire organizers, along with a couple dozen ride participants (above), gathered at the Airport Fire Station in July, to present a $2,000 cheque to the Boots on the Ground organization. The money was raised during the second annual Ride with Fire cycling event that took place on July 1st . It was created by Brant Fire Captain Mark Stouffer in 2022. The century ride (100km) spans all eight County of Brant Fire Stations.

**The Paris FC U16 Boys’ Team (pictured left) travelled to Kingston to participate in the Gaels Cup. The team was undefeated all weekend and won the Cup to claim gold medals.

**County of Brant Fire Department remembers longtime volunteer firefighter, Deputy District Chief Dewey Robinson following his death. Dewey’s remarkable history with the department was preceded by two generations of firefighters.

**Paris’ Zac Dalpe (to the left with his family), NHL player with the Florida Panthers, returns home in honour of a banner raising ceremony dedicated to the local hockey hero. “I grew up seeing names like Syl Apps, Doug Stewart and Tyler Pelton (in the rafters) and I always wanted to have the status they had,” Dalpe told the Paris Independent.
